## Fazenda Boaventura (Abrantes, Camaçari, Bahia): what it is and what you can actually do there
Fazenda Boaventura is a rural leisure and events property in the district of Abrantes (Camaçari), in the state of Bahia, Brazil, associated with day-use openings and programmed activities that lean into “farm life + nature + adventure” rather than a passive park stroll. It’s promoted as having about 130,000 m² of Atlantic Forest (Mata Atlântica), pasture, and recreation areas. Boa Aventura
### Where it is
The address most commonly published for Fazenda Boaventura is Rua da Barragem – Abrantes, Camaçari – BA, Brazil.
It’s described as being in Abrantes, around 10 minutes from the Estrada do Coco (BA-099 corridor). Boa Aventura

## What makes it different from a typical “park” stop
Fazenda Boaventura positions itself as a place where you can mix hands-on rural experiences with structured recreation and adventure elements—and it also functions as a venue for organized groups and private events.
### Farm-style “vivências” (hands-on rural activities)
A major draw highlighted in reporting and official descriptions is the set of experiences that mirror daily farm routines, including:
– Milking (ordenha) and animal contact in farm areas
– Visits to a vegetable garden (horta) and systems like a composter (composteira) and worm farm (minhocário)
– An apiary (apiário) (beekeeping context is mentioned as part of the experience set) 24 Horas
If you’re traveling with kids—or you’re an adult who actually likes tactile learning—this is the kind of activity mix that tends to land better than “look, don’t touch” attractions, when it’s offered on the day you visit.
### Adventure park elements
Fazenda Boaventura also advertises a dedicated adventure/sports area with activities such as:
– Arvorismo (aerial/rope course)
– Slackline
– Climbing (escalada)
– A 200-meter zipline (tirolesa de 200 m) Boa Aventura
If your trip needs a “movement” component (and not just food + photos), this adventure infrastructure is one of the clearest differentiators versus many rural day-use spaces that are mostly lawns and a restaurant.
### Trails with themed names
On its own site, the farm lists trails through the Mata Atlântica with themed points/labels including:
– “Vale dos dinossauros”
– “Homem das cavernas”
– “Floresta encantada” Boa Aventura
Treat these as experience branding rather than formal ecological trail classifications—still useful if you’re trying to choose between “short attention span walk” vs “let’s actually hike a bit.”
## Facilities you can reasonably expect (based on published descriptions)
From the farm’s own “A Fazenda” page, the advertised infrastructure includes:
– A covered event hall for up to 250 people, with kitchen, barbecue area, bathrooms, and stage
– A barbecue kiosk listed with capacity for 120 people
– Closed parking for about 60 vehicles
– A climate-controlled training room for ~30 people (projector + coffee-break space)
– Soccer field with changing rooms
– A children’s play area with features like mini-zipline and other play equipment
– A labyrinth and pool (both listed)
– A small-scale dairy/cheese-making area (queijaria) (described as for homemade dairy production) Boa Aventura
That mix tells you the place isn’t only “nature.” It’s built to host groups—school outings, corporate days, social events—which often means better bathrooms, shaded structures, and logistics than a purely wild area.
## When to go (and what to verify first)
On Instagram, the operation is described as open to the public one to two Sundays per month (day-use style), which implies you shouldn’t assume daily opening like a city park.
Outdated-data flag: schedules, day-use dates, and entry rules can change quickly (and social posts may lag). Before you go, verify:
– The next public Day Use date
– Whether specific activities (milking, zipline, trails) are running that day
– Any age/height rules for adventure activities
– What on-site food options are available that day (if any)
The most reliable sources to check are the farm’s official website and official social profiles. Boa Aventura
## Getting there: practical route context (without pretending it’s the only way)
A Bahia newspaper piece describes arriving via Estrada do Coco, using a return before a toll area, and following signage toward local developments (e.g., Alphaville Litoral Norte area) to find the farm. 24 Horas
Because that level of direction can become outdated if road layouts or toll patterns change, treat it as context—not gospel—and confirm the live route in your map app plus the farm’s latest guidance.
If you’re driving, note the property advertises on-site parking. Boa Aventura
## Who this visit tends to work for
### Good fit if you want:
– A family-focused rural day with structured activities (especially if kids benefit from hands-on learning)
– A group outing (school, corporate, social) where bathrooms, covered areas, and parking matter Boa Aventura
– A mix of Mata Atlântica trails + light adventure in one stop Boa Aventura
### Potential friction points to plan around:
– Limited public opening days (often 1–2 Sundays/month)
– The experience can be program-dependent (some activities may be scheduled, seasonal, or staff-led rather than “anytime”) Boa Aventura
– Accessibility specifics aren’t consistently published in the sources above; if someone in your group needs step-free paths, mobility-friendly bathrooms, or sensory accommodations, contact the farm ahead of time to confirm what’s available.
